Sinoatrial Node Dysfunction And Deafness

Description

Sinoatrial node dysfunction and deafness is a rare genetic disease characterized by congenital severe to profound deafness with no evidence of vestibular dysfunction, associated with sinoatrial node dysfunction with pronounced bradycardia and increased variability of heart rate at rest and episodic syncopes that may be triggered by enhanced physical activity and stress.

Clinical Features

Phenotypes and symptoms related to Sinoatrial Node Dysfunction And Deafness

  • Hearing impairment
  • Syncope
  • Bradycardia
  • Vestibular dysfunction
  • Abnormal atrioventricular conduction
  • Abnormal electrophysiology of sinoatrial node origin
